Data Centers: The Hub of Cloud Operations

Data centers are the central hubs where cloud computing hardware is housed. Companies like Amazon Web Services (AWS), Microsoft Azure, and Google Cloud Platform (GCP) have established large-scale data centers across the UK. These facilities are equipped with high-performance servers, advanced storage solutions, and sophisticated networking infrastructure.

Hardware Innovations

UK-based companies are at the forefront of hardware innovation, particularly in areas such as server design and energy efficiency. For instance, ARM Holdings, a UK-based semiconductor company, has developed highly efficient processor architectures that are widely used in cloud data centers. These innovations not only reduce energy consumption but also enhance the overall performance of cloud services.

Security and Compliance

Security is a paramount concern in cloud computing, and UK computing hardware plays a vital role in ensuring the integrity and confidentiality of data.

Cloud Security Measures

UK data centers and cloud providers implement robust security measures, including physical security, network security, and data encryption. For example, AWS has its own security service, AWS Shield, which protects against DDoS attacks.

- **Physical security**: Secure facilities with access controls, surveillance, and on-site security personnel.
- **Network security**: Firewalls, intrusion detection systems, and secure network protocols.
- **Data encryption**: Encrypting data both in transit and at rest to protect against unauthorized access.

Compliance with Regulations

UK computing hardware and cloud services must comply with various national and international regulations, such as the General Data Protection Regulation (GDPR) and the UK Data Protection Act.

- **GDPR compliance**: Ensuring that data processing and storage meet the stringent requirements of GDPR.
- **Industry-specific regulations**: Compliance with regulations specific to industries like finance, healthcare, and government.
- **Regular audits and certifications**: Maintaining certifications like ISO 27001 to ensure ongoing compliance.

Future Directions

As cloud computing continues to evolve, the role of UK computing hardware is expected to become even more critical.

Hybrid and Multi-Cloud Models

There is a growing trend towards hybrid and multi-cloud models, where businesses use a combination of public, private, and on-premises cloud services. UK computing hardware will need to support these complex access models seamlessly.

- **Hybrid cloud**: Integrating public and private cloud services for a unified experience.
- **Multi-cloud**: Using multiple public cloud providers to avoid vendor lock-in and optimize costs.
- **Edge computing**: Processing data closer to the source to reduce latency and improve real-time processing.

Emerging Technologies

Technologies like machine learning, artificial intelligence, and the Internet of Things (IoT) are driving new demands on cloud infrastructure. UK computing hardware must be capable of supporting these advanced applications.

- **Machine learning**: Specialized hardware for machine learning workloads, such as GPUs and TPUs.
- **Artificial intelligence**: Infrastructure to support AI applications, including natural language processing and computer vision.
- **IoT**: Handling the vast amounts of data generated by IoT devices and enabling real-time analytics.
